Tom Peters Jr., Helen Peters and Mr. Tom Peters Sr.
These three members of the Peters family will be installed as presidents of Fort Worth, Texas\u27 American Hellenic organizations. They are Tom Peters Senior, right, new president of the Fort Worth, Texas Chapter Number 19, Order of Ahepa, and his son and daughter, Tom Peters Junior, left, president of the Fort Worth, Texas Chapter, Sons of Pericles, and Miss Helen Peters, center, president of Thetis Chapter, Daughters of Penelope. They are sitting on a couch in the living room of the Peters residence, 5000 Pershing Avenue. Tom Peters Junior and Tom Peters Senior are wearing suits and Miss Helen Peters is wearing a dress and necklace. She is holding a magazine titled, The Ave Maria that they are all looking at. Tom Peters and Management: A history of organizational storytelling
Tom Peters is the management guru's management guru. His is the story that launched a thousand management stories. This new book offers a critical assessment of Tom Peters' contribution to management thought and practice.
The author, a globally recognized expert on management gurus, places Tom Peters at the forefront of the narrative turn in management. Charting and accounting for Tom Peters’ contributions to management, the book analyses the practices that Peters has used to shape our appreciation of the business of excellence and in so doing probes and accounts for the preferences of the excellence project.
An accessible and illuminating work, the book will appeal to students and scholars as well as thoughtful managers and leaders
